We are looking for an experienced Talent Acquisition Director to lead executive and strategic hiring efforts for a growing organization in Greer, South Carolina. This role is ideal for a senior recruiting leader who can shape talent strategy, guide high-level search activity, and build strong partnerships with business leaders across a complex global environment. The successful candidate will combine market insight, operational discipline, and a hands-on approach to deliver exceptional hiring outcomes while strengthening recruiting capabilities.
Job Responsibility:
Lead the design and execution of enterprise talent acquisition strategies that support business growth and long-term workforce plans
Manage senior-level and executive searches from market mapping through offer negotiation, ensuring a high-quality candidate experience and strong close rates
Partner closely with executive stakeholders to understand organizational priorities, define talent needs, and influence hiring decisions with confidence and credibility
Use labor market research, competitive intelligence, and talent insights to identify hiring opportunities and develop targeted search approaches
Oversee recruiting technology initiatives, including the implementation and improvement of enterprise hiring systems and related processes
Establish and monitor recruiting metrics to evaluate performance, improve efficiency, and support data-driven decision-making
Mentor and guide recruiting teams while balancing strategic leadership with direct involvement in critical searches and hiring projects
Collaborate effectively across regions and time zones, building trusted relationships with globally distributed teams in a multicultural business setting
Requirements:
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business, or a related discipline is required
an advanced degree or relevant certification is preferred
At least 10 years of progressive talent acquisition experience, including substantial background in both agency executive search and corporate in-house recruiting environments
Demonstrated success hiring senior leaders and executives, with strong expertise in search strategy, talent mapping, and competitive market analysis
Experience supporting fast-growing global organizations, ideally within manufacturing, data center, cooling, or closely related industries
Strong knowledge of recruiting technology, including hands-on involvement with applicant tracking systems and broader talent acquisition tools
Excellent stakeholder management, communication, negotiation, and influencing skills, particularly when working with senior executives
Analytical mindset with experience using recruiting data, performance metrics, and reporting to guide hiring strategy and continuous improvement
High level of sound judgment, resilience, and ability to manage multiple priorities effectively in a fast-paced environment
